Human behavior is often characterized by deviations from perfect rationality and influenced by numerous factors that could the researcher’s view of underlying causalities. Exploring antecedents of human behavior provides a pathway for managers in making evidenced-based management decisions. Thus, I have an interest in contributing to a deeper understanding of modeling consumer behavior. Through my research journey, I have published papers on modeling consumer behavior, primarily in the context of service marketing, impulse buying, and healthcare.
